What Are Vesa Certified DP Cables?
Vesa Certified DP cables are cables that have been tested and approved by the Video Electronics Standards Association (VESA). This certification ensures that the cable meets strict standards for performance, reliability, and safety. These standards cover aspects such as bandwidth capacity, signal integrity, and compatibility with various display technologies.
Key Benefits of Vesa Certified DP Cables
- Guaranteed Performance: Vesa Certified cables support the latest DisplayPort standards, including high resolutions and refresh rates.
- Reliability: Certification ensures consistent quality, reducing the risk of signal loss or degradation.
- Compatibility: Certified cables are compatible with a wide range of devices, from monitors to gaming consoles.
- Future-Proofing: They are designed to support upcoming display technologies and higher bandwidth requirements.
Are Vesa Certified DP Cables Worth the Extra Cost?
Deciding whether to invest in Vesa Certified DP cables depends on your specific use case and budget. If you require high-resolution displays, fast refresh rates, or are setting up a professional or gaming environment, the added assurance of certification can be worth the extra expense. These cables reduce the risk of signal issues that could compromise image quality or cause connection failures.
For casual users or those with standard display setups, non-certified cables might suffice. However, even in these cases, choosing certified cables can provide peace of mind and a longer lifespan for your equipment.
What to Look for When Buying Vesa Certified DP Cables
- Certification Label: Ensure the cable explicitly states Vesa Certification.
- Bandwidth Support: Check that the cable supports the required DisplayPort version (e.g., 1.4, 2.0).
- Length and Build Quality: Choose a length suitable for your setup and look for durable connectors and shielding.
- Brand Reputation: Purchase from reputable manufacturers with positive reviews.
